GASTAT issues the results of the Health and Safety at Workplace Statistics Publication for 2025

28-04-2026

The General Authority for Statistics (GASTAT) released the results of the Health and Safety at Workplace Statistics Publication for 2025. According to the results, the risk awareness index among workers aged 18 years and above reached 76.7%. The rate of occupational injuries among workers aged 15 years and above recorded 245 non-fatal injuries and 1.3 fatal injuries per 100,000 workers, excluding road traffic accidents.
The results showed that 51.8% of workers reported the availability of preventive measures implemented by their workplace, while 46.6% indicated the availability of at least one initiative aimed at facilitating daily work tasks. In addition, 34.5% of workers reported the availability of at least one resource provided by the work entity that supports their personal health.
The publication also indicated that Prolonged standing (for at least 4 hours per day) is the most common risk in the workplace, accounting for 25.3%, followed by Fatigue or working beyond one’s capacity at 16.7%. Regarding work-related health problems during the past twelve months, the results showed that work-related stress ranked first at 6%, followed by eye and vision problems at 3%.
It is worth noting that the Health and Safety at Workplace Statistics estimates are based on self-completion data collected from participants through household field visits under the National Health Survey 2025. Meanwhile, the occupational injury rate was calculated based on administrative records data from the National Council for Occupational Safety and Health.
